Problems solved by technology

However, since bream is a fish sensitive to low oxygen, low oxygen content causes huge economic losses during the breeding process. In addition, bream grows relatively slowly
In the existing technology, the operation process of obtaining gynogenetic bream is cumbersome, and the selection requirements for sperm parent, sperm inactivation method, and chromosome doubling method are very strict, and the obtained gynogenetic bream are all female offspring , these deficiencies limit the application of gynogenetic bream in production practice

[0031] A method for cultivating natural gynogenetic bream, comprising the steps of:

[0032] (1) 2-3 months before the breeding season, select female bream and male yellow-tailed pomfret with beautiful body, no disease and injury, and obvious sexual maturity characteristics as parents to raise them in a special pond. The water quality in the special pond is required to be good. High oxygen content and sufficient light; in addition, especially one month before breeding, take care of them carefully, feed them with fine bait, and stimulate them with running water once a day to promote the maturation of the gonads;

Abstract

The invention discloses a method for cultivating natural gynogenetic bream. The bream is used as the female parent, and the yellow-tailed pomfret is used as the male parent. To induce labor, the dose of LRH‑A is 8‑10 μg / kg, and the dose of HCG is 400‑500 IU / kg; inject the female parent fish first, and then artificially inject the mixed oxytocic agent of LRH‑A and HCG to the father parent fish after 3 hours. To induce labor, the injection dose is half of that of the parent fish, and the intraperitoneal injection method is adopted at the base of the pectoral fin without scales; after artificial insemination, running water incubation, breeding, testing and screening, the natural gynogenetic bream is obtained. The cultivation method of the present invention changes the activity of the eggs and sperm of the parents, and then obtains the natural gynogenetic bream that is sexually fertile. During the entire cultivation process, technical treatments such as inactivation of sperm and doubling of eggs are not required, which greatly improves Reduced workload.

Description

technical field [0001] The invention relates to a method for distant hybrid breeding of fish, in particular to a method for preparing natural gynogenetic group bream by distant hybridization between the bream and the subfamilies of the subfamily Yellow-tailed pomfret. Background technique [0002] Distant hybridization refers to the hybridization between species whose genetic relationship is interspecific or above, which can transfer the genome from one species to another, resulting in changes in the genotype and phenotype of the offspring. Distant hybridization can also produce gynogenetic offspring, so that natural gynogenetic offspring show heterozygous effects in terms of meat quality, disease resistance, stress resistance, and growth speed, and thus form sexually fertile offspring through distant hybridization.
